BACKGROUND:
Attac hed is a copy of the November 19 , 20 13 staff repori s ubmitted to the Co mmunity
Development Bo ard (CDB) to discuss City Code Secti on 24-84 (c) which relates to throu gh lots
along Beach Avenue and Ocean Bou levard. This sec tion requires doub le frontage lots extending
from Beach A venue to Ocean Bou leva rd to have the front yard face Ocean Bou levard. As
indicated to the COB, I 0 of the 22 tlu·o ugh lots already front and have a Beach Avenue address.
Only 4 through lots are add ressed and front alon g Ocean Boulevard, the other lots have side
street addresses. Current ly the ordinance requires an existing throu gh prope rty to redi rect the
front ya rd to Ocean Avenue if the existing stru cture is demo lished and rebuil t. Staff requests the
Co mmi ssion eliminate this porti on of Section 24-84 to allow through lots to fi·ont o nto e ither
Beach A venue or Ocean Bou levard. Below is a li s t of through lot addresses fronting o nto Beach
Avenue.

The CDB voted un animous ly (see attached draft minutes) to request Section 24-84 (c) be
amended to a llow through lots along Beach Avenue and Ocean Boulevard to front along Beach
Avenue. Our Publi c Works Department do es not object to this amendment and docs no t co nsider
thi s as adding a traffi c impact upon th is portion of Beach Avenue.

This is to request a re co mmenda tion from the Community Development Board to the City
Co mmi ssion that through lots between Beach Avenue and Ocean Boulevard be allowed to have
front yards that access along Beach A venue. C it y Co de Section 24 -8 4. (c) Double frontage lot s
states, "Special treatment of Ocean Boulevard lots with douhle .frontage. For double frontage lot s
extendin g between Beach Aven ue and Ocean Bou levard , the required front yard sha ll be the ya rd ,
which faces Ocean Boulevard."
Currently th ere are 22 tota l thro ug h lots between Beach A venue and Ocean Bou levard with I 0 lots
addressed on Beach Avenue, 5 lots addressed on s ide streets, 4 l ots with Ocean Bouleva rd
add resses, and 3 vacant lo ts with no address. Given the current ava il able acces s and street width
there d ocs not appear to be a reaso n Beach Avenue cannot handle the possibl e 7 properties that
ma y want to hav e access to Beach Avenue. Our Public Works Dep a1i me nt has no objection to
allowing the remainder of lots to fTOnt onto Ocea n Boulevard.

Sec. 24-84. Double frontage lots.
(a) Double frontage lots. On double frontage lots, the required
front yard shall be provided on each street, except for lots as set
forth below and as set forth in section 24-88
(b) Special treatment of ocean-front Lots. For lots having frontage
on the Atlantic Ocean, the front yard shall be the yard which faces
the Atlantic Ocean, and the required front yard shall be measured
from the lot line parallel to or nearest the ocean.
(c) Special treatment of Ocean Boultward lots with double
frontage. For double frontage lots extending betv;een Beach
Avenue and Ocean Boulevard, the required front yard shall be the
yard, which faces Ocean Boulevard.

A. Through Lots. Michael Griffin stated that this item is to request a
recommendation from the Community Development Board to the City
Commission to repeal Section 24-84. (c) The Land Development Code which
relates to double frontage lots which requires new structures built in between
Beach Avenue and Ocean Blvd. to actually front onto Ocean Blvd. Currently
there are only 4 lots with Ocean Blvd addresses and 10 lots addressed on Beach
Avenue, and 3 vacant lots with no address. Sylvia Simmons is concerned about
letting homeowners place 6ft tall fences right along Ocean Blvd. Mr. Parkes
stated that the economic value of having a Beach Ave. address is not arguable.
Kelly Elmore made a motion to amend the code to allow through lots between
Beach Ave. to Ocean Blvd. to front on Beach Ave. Mr. Stratton seconded the
motion. The motion was unanimously approved 6-0.
